>>The Rehabilitation Research and Training Center (RRTC) on Blindness and
>>Low Vision at Mississippi State University (MSU) has received funding from
>>the National Institute on Disability and Rehabilitation Research (NIDRR)
>>to support a Jennings Randolph Research Awards Program. The program
>>entails two $500 research awards that are to be made to rehabilitation
>>practitioners or graduate students who are interested in conducting
>>employment related research in the field of blindness or low vision. These
>>funds may be used for development of questionnaires, postage for mailing
>>survey instruments, travel to collect data or other appropriate research
>>activities that focus on employment outcomes for people who are blind.
>>Projects are not limited to just the Business Enterprise Program. RRTC
>>Research Staff will be glad to serve as a resource as needed in the
>>applicant's research endeavors, including assistance with statistical
>>analyses. A brief application is required and a copy can be obtained by
